About your question on CIRs in LEED:

I think LEED 2009 reviewers aren't bound by any previous CIRs - http://www.gbci.org/Certification/Resources/cirs.aspx

However, the rumors continue that this could be changing, with "LEED Interpretations" - http://www.leeduser.com/topic/usgbc-offer-precedent-setting-leed-interpretations-along-cirs

The first link clearly affirms my concerns for the present...

I suppose it's positive news that precedent-setting credit
interpretations have been in the works, though it seems wonky to my eyes
that the submitting team would have to pay an extra fee to have the
ruling be precedent-setting... That 'feature' seems to draw a line
between "regular" interpretations and "quality" interpretations that may
be referenced for future projects and be made publicly available...
shouldn't all submitted CIR responses be of a quality standard that
allows for setting precedent?
